The key issue is to avoid errors and prevent boiling the fish
The most important problem to pay attention to when using heating tubes is to test the temperature difference in advance, and a better quality thermometer is equipped as a reference value for monitoring the actual water temperature, because most of the heating tubes' display temperature is not very accurate.
For example, although the heating rod shows 30 degrees, it is possible that the actual water temperature is only 28 degrees, or 32 degrees, which is very normal.
Therefore, all experienced aquarists must start testing whether the heating tube works normally and whether the temperature is accurate three days before the ornamental fish enter the tank.
No matter what kind of principle of heating tube, there may be errors or accidentally cook fish, and some aquarists, will buy a separate thermostat, and the heating tube together, so that the use, will be more secure.
Although there is a formula, this formula can only be used as a rough reference
Although there is a formula for the choice of heating tubes, which roughly says that 1 liter of water can choose a heating tube of 2 watts, this value is only a very general reference value.
Many aquarists will ask, you see, I am a one-meter fish tank, how big a heating tube do I need?
In fact, looking at this kind of question is a layman, who does not understand too many variables at all:
First, how many degrees will our room temperature be, and how many degrees do we want to increase?
This is a question that would have come to mind easily, such as:
My room temperature is only 8 degrees, I want to heat the fish tank at a constant temperature of 32 degrees, and my room temperature is 25 degrees all year round, I want to heat to 30 degrees, this heating tube choice, may it be the same?
It is possible that in the first case, a meter of fish tank, 100 liters of water, and a 300-watt heating tube may not be enough, while in the second case, a 100-watt heating tube can be achieved, and a 200-watt heating tube is more safe.

Second, is there any insulation measure, can the fish tank open the lid?
The second point is whether the fish tank has insulation measures?
This point is of course also very important, this problem I have long said, in addition to the front, the side of the other fish tank includes the bottom surface, all wrapped by thermal insulation equipment, this cooling amplitude must be very slow, the working time of the heating tube can be effectively shortened.
Including whether the fish tank is with a lid or completely open, the heat loss in it, there will be a big difference.
Third, the filtration form, the length of the filter tank, the size of the water flow, the frequency of water change, etc., are all related
These things don't need to be explained too much, or is it a problem of heat loss, a small fish tank with only a water goblin wrapped tightly on all sides, and a drip box completely open to the drip stream, can its fish tank heat loss be the same, it is simply impossible.
In addition, there are many factors such as our water change frequency, feeding frequency, cylinder opening frequency and so on.
Therefore, since we use heating tubes, we need to consider the above factors to minimize the loss of heat energy in the fish tank, but at the same time, we must also take into account proper ventilation, especially in winter.
In addition, in the case of careful wrapping of the fish tank, the water temperature of the large fish tank is definitely more constant, even if there is a problem, the cooling speed is slow, and the water body must be large.
Moreover, we also leave a certain amount of space in the power selection of the heating tube, especially when the room temperature is not too constant, for example, my two monk fish, although it is an 80 cm fish tank, want to heat to 32 degrees, or need at least 300 watts of heating tubes, I use 500 watts, in fact, it is more stable, and it will not cost more electricity.
